Several factors can contribute to the failure of lithium batteries. Understanding these causes can help in preventing and managing battery issues: Aging: Like all batteries, lithium batteries degrade over time. The chemical reactions that generate power eventually reduce their effectiveness.
First, don't let your batteries fully discharge. Lithium-ion batteries prefer partial cycles over full ones, so it's best to recharge before they completely drain out. Second, avoid exposing your batteries to extreme temperatures, especially heat. High temperatures can cause irreversible damage to the battery's capacity.
